FREQUENT AWS AND CLOUDFLARE DISRUPTIONS DRIVE FRESH DEMAND FOR OUTAGE COVER

- BY NIVETHA DAYANAND

After back-to-back global outages from AWS and Cloudflare, businesses in the UAE are beginning to look at cloud insurance the same way they once viewed cyber protection.

Basil Mimi, Co-Founder and CEO of Mantas, said the pattern has been building for years as more local companies migrated core functions to the cloud.

He pointed out that “cloud platforms are now the backbone of most UAE businesses,” and with SAP estimating that two-thirds of enterprises rely on cloud systems for daily operations, even a brief outage can freeze sales, break SLAs and stall internal systems. Insurance, he noted, gives companies a buffer when the infrastructure they depend on goes dark.

Cost of downtime

For small businesses that run payments, deliveries, or bookings through third-party platforms, the damage is immediate. Mimi said a half-hour disruption can wipe out an entire day’s margin once lost transactions, delayed orders, and idle staff are factored in.

Outage cover typically reimburses lost revenue and the additional costs needed to keep operations running, while giving firms enough flexibility to handle customer communication during a crisis.
